This "modern Audubon" will show you how to keep a nature journal to become a better artist, as well as a more attentive naturalist. Dozens of exercises lead the hand and mind through creating accurate reproductions of what you observe, from a single wildflower to a majestic vista. Laws's emphasis on seeing, learning, and feeling will make this book valuable, even revelatory, to anyone interested in the natural world.
Heyday Books, 2016. Paperback, 303 pp.
